Output 40f886e4a393316a9a0437f1523665017853dde622c05a16a41f6742572fcd65:0

value
42980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b22ca9b8c164793958a08fc9b5c6c5bd63ce1721 OP_EQUALVERIFY OP_CHECKSIG
address
1HF6nPFvwRUPQsBBa7EquT3F5Jgtw61gCc
transaction
40f886e4a393316a9a0437f1523665017853dde622c05a16a41f6742572fcd65
confirmations
387862
spent
true